首页 电脑常识文章正文

阿里云esc服务器ftp安全组的作用是什么?

电脑常识 2025年04月15日 09:28 3 游客

在数字时代,企业与个人越来越依赖云计算服务来处理数据和部署应用。阿里云作为全球领先的云服务提供商,其提供的ECS(ElasticComputeService,弹性计算服务)让用户能够轻松拥有并管理自己的服务器。在使用ECS服务器时,我们经常需要远程管理文件,其中FTP(FileTransferProtocol,文件传输协议)是常用的一种方式。但是,服务器的安全性始终是用户最为关注的问题之一。这时,安全组就起到了关键作用。本文将详细探讨阿里云ECS服务器中FTP安全组的作用,以及如何正确配置安全组以保障FTP服务的安全。

什么是安全组?

在深入了解安全组在FTP中的作用前,首先需要明白安全组是什么。简单来说,安全组相当于阿里云中的一种虚拟防火墙,用于控制ECS实例的入站和出站流量。每个ECS实例都必须关联至少一个安全组,而每个安全组中可以设置多个安全组规则来允许或拒绝特定的流量。

阿里云esc服务器ftp安全组的作用是什么?

FTP安全组的作用

FTP是一种文件传输协议,它允许用户上传和下载文件到远程服务器。然而,由于FTP协议在数据传输时,包括用户名和密码在内的所有数据都是以明文形式发送的,这使得FTP服务非常容易受到网络攻击,如数据截获、中间人攻击等。

在阿里云ECS服务器中,通过安全组可以对FTP服务进行如下安全管控:

1.限制访问源IP:用户可以设置安全组规则,仅允许来自特定IP地址或IP范围的FTP访问请求。这有助于减少未经授权的用户尝试连接FTP服务器。

2.控制端口:FTP服务默认在20和21端口进行数据和控制信息的传输。通过设置安全组规则,用户可以自定义这些端口,增加安全性。

3.加密FTP连接:虽然FTP协议本身不提供加密,但用户可以通过设置安全组规则来强制使用安全连接,例如使用SFTP(SecureFileTransferProtocol,安全文件传输协议)或FTPS(FTPSecure,FTP的安全版本),从而增强数据传输过程中的安全。

阿里云esc服务器ftp安全组的作用是什么?

如何配置FTP安全组

为了确保FTP服务的安全,正确配置安全组规则至关重要。以下是一个基本的配置流程:

第一步:创建安全组

在阿里云控制台中,找到安全组管理界面,创建一个新的安全组,并为该安全组命名和描述。

第二步:添加入站规则

在新创建的安全组中添加入站规则,设置允许FTP访问的规则。这些规则应该包括:

允许来自特定IP地址的FTP连接(端口21)。

如使用SFTP或FTPS,相应添加22端口(SSH)或990端口(FTPS)的入站规则。

第三步:添加出站规则

出于安全和合规考虑,也需要为出站流量设置规则。虽然对于FTP来说,出站规则通常较为宽松,但最好也进行适当限制。

第四步:应用安全组

将新配置的安全组应用到目标ECS实例上。此时,所有的FTP访问都将遵循新设定的规则。

阿里云esc服务器ftp安全组的作用是什么?

常见问题解答

Q:我应该如何选择哪些IP地址被允许连接到我的FTP服务器?

A:应首先考虑业务需求,只有那些必需的IP地址或IP段才应被添加到入站规则中。一般来说,如果你的FTP服务器面向的是外部用户,需要允许广泛的IP地址。对于内部FTP服务器,可能只限于公司内部网络的IP范围。

Q:如果我想要使用SFTP或FTPS代替传统FTP,应该怎么做?

A:确保你的FTP客户端支持SFTP或FTPS。在ECS实例中安装并配置支持这些协议的服务,如OpenSSH。在安全组中添加允许相应端口(对于SFTP是22端口,对于FTPS是990端口)的入站规则。

综上所述

阿里云ECS服务器的FTP安全组是一个强大的安全工具,它通过允许和拒绝特定的流量,为用户提供了一个灵活的、可定制的方式来保护FTP服务免受未授权访问和潜在的网络威胁。通过合理配置安全组,用户能够确保FTP服务既满足业务需求,又具有较高的安全性。在数字时代,安全始终是至关重要的,而阿里云提供的安全组功能是保障服务器安全的关键手段之一。

标签: 服务器

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 3561739510@qq.com 举报,一经查实,本站将立刻删除。

Copyright © www.jszcfw.com All Rights Reserved. 滇ICP备2023005829号 图片来源于网络,如有侵权请联系删除